About Dandan Zhao

Dandan Zhao is a scholar working on Molecular Biology, Plant Science, Epidemiology, Immunology and Cancer Research, having authored 19 papers that have together received 333 indexed citations. Recurring topics across this work include Phytochemistry and Biological Activities (4 papers), Virology and Viral Diseases (3 papers), Natural product bioactivities and synthesis (3 papers), Natural Compound Pharmacology Studies (3 papers), RNA Interference and Gene Delivery (2 papers), Biological Activity of Diterpenoids and Biflavonoids (2 papers), Atherosclerosis and Cardiovascular Diseases (2 papers) and Biomarkers in Disease Mechanisms (1 paper). The work is most often cited by research in Complementary and alternative medicine (36 citations), Biochemistry (21 citations), Plant Science (76 citations), Molecular Biology (122 citations) and Infectious Diseases (31 citations). Dandan Zhao has collaborated with scholars based in China, Japan and United States. Frequent co-authors include Yanlong Zhang, Lili Jiang, Hongyi Li, Fenghua Zhou, Yuhua Jia, Lei Hong, Qin‐Shi Zhao, Zhongqin Chen, Li Liu and Jing Wang. Their work appears in journals such as Molecules, Journal of Environmental Management, BioMed Research International, Immunobiology and Materials Science and Engineering A.
